N.S. Ceramic Coating for Concrete

Protective Ceramic Coatings for Concrete:

Formulated for the extremely large market of Factory Floors/Loading Docks/Marine Docks; Highway Bridge Decks, etc. where extreme wear is common and heavy-duty protection is required. Excellent wear protection from mechanical attack, such as high abrasion, high impact, high heat, etc.

Preparation and Application:

Surface preparation: Concrete - no oil/grease/fats. Acid-etch may be required for very smooth (cement-rich mixture, or cement cap) concrete. Metals - no oil/grease/fats.

Application Methods: Cement/concrete helicopter trowel machine; Hopper gun; Screed; Hard trowel.

Application Coverage: 30 - 250 sq. ft. gallon depending upon surface porosity and application method.

C) Insulation of Steel Beams/Girders/Piping Used in construction of buildings. Steel can transmit heat from basement fire to the roof, setting it on fire. Code calls for cladding to insulate steel to reduce fire transfer probability. Most competitors apply their material up to 3-4 inch cladding thickness or more, resulting in a very time and labor-intensive application.

NOTE: When N.S. coating is combined with our Proprietary Additives and is applied to steel substrate by spray gun at approximately 1/8 thickness. The N.S. coating then expands shortly after the application to a thickness of up to 1.5, providing exceptional insulating and fireproofing qualities.

Fire/heat transfer prevention is excellent.
